当前位置 博文首页 > fearlazy:Qt图形视图框架基本图元

    fearlazy:Qt图形视图框架基本图元

    作者:[db:作者] 时间:2021-06-18 18:37

    ? 原文链接:http://www.fearlazy.com/index.php/post/104.html

    ? ?Qt图形视图框架三要素:视图、场景和图元,其中图元是组成图形的元素,也就是图形的内容所在。 Qt封装了一些常用的图形元素供我们使用,如初识图形视图框架中使用的QGraphicsRectItem就是其中一个。除此以外还有QGraphicsEllipseItem(椭圆)、QGraphicsPolygonItem(多边形)、QGraphicsSimpleTextItem(文本)和QGraphicsPathItem(路径)。接下来欣赏一下这些图元。

    ????1.矩形图元

    blob.png

    ?2.椭圆图元

    blob.png

    ? ? 扇形

    blob.png

    其中startAngle为起始度数,spanAngle为偏移度数,例子中*16是将角度转换为弧度。

    ?

    3.多边形

    blob.png

    4.文本,简单的文本可以设置字体和内容。

    blob.png

    5.路径

    blob.png

    ?

    ? 我是fearlazy!文章内容仅代表个人观点如有雷同纯属正常。